Roof sealing services involve applying protective coatings or sealants to a roof’s surface to prevent water infiltration and improve durability. These services are suitable for a variety of projects, including repairing minor leaks, extending the lifespan of asphalt shingles, sealing flat roofs, or maintaining metal and tile roofing systems. Homeowners typically seek roof sealing to safeguard their property against weather-related damage, reduce the risk of leaks, and enhance the overall performance of their roofing system.

Before requesting roof sealing, property owners usually want to understand the current condition of their roof, the types of sealants or coatings that are appropriate, and the expected benefits of sealing. It’s important to consider factors such as roof material, age, and exposure to the elements, as these influence the choice of sealing products and techniques. Proper assessment ensures the sealing process effectively addresses existing issues and provides long-lasting protection for the property.

Roof Sealing Questions

What is roof sealing? Roof sealing involves applying a protective coating to prevent water penetration and extend the roof's lifespan.

When should roof sealing be considered? It is recommended when there are signs of leaks, cracks, or after repairs to ensure the roof remains watertight.

What types of roofs can be sealed? Most common roof types, including asphalt shingles, metal, and flat roofs, can benefit from sealing.

How often does roof sealing need to be redone? Typically, sealing should be inspected and reapplied every few years or as needed based on weather exposure and condition.
